Can you be a widow to an ex spouse?

Since you were divorced before the death of the spouse, they became at the time of the divorce, unrelated to you in any way, save as an ex spouse. You can by definition, only be a widow to someone who you were married to at the time of their demise.

How long can a couple stay separated after a divorce?

Studies indicate that the overwhelming majority of married couples who legally separate get divorced within 3 years of their separation. On the other hand, roughly 15% remain separated indefinitely, many for ten years and longer. So why would a couple choose to remain legally separated indefinitely rather than getting a divorce?

Can a home that was purchased before marriage be divided?

General Rule. A home that was purchased prior to the marriage and owned by one spouse is generally considered separate property and is not subject to division. However, there are exceptions to this rule.

Who are the actors in the lost husband?

The Lost Husband is a 2020 American romance film written and directed by Vicky Wight and starring Leslie Bibb and Josh Duhamel. It is based on Katherine Center ‘s 2013 novel of the same name. [2] [3] The film was released to video on demand on April 10, 2020 by Quiver Distribution and Redbox Entertainment .
